      I had counselling by Skype video with a new counsellor person when a I had an injury and was housebound. For me it worked well, just wished I had a bigger screen! The counselling was my first step to where I am now so in retropsect it worked. I only ended it because I knew needed to see someone in the flesh and who knew about coercive control or had expertise in that and trauma. I am about to ask my current psychologist to see me by Skype for the next session. Video counselling is not as good as in person but if you have a pre established relationship that is a major advantage. I felt lucky to be able to do it when I needed it because otherwise I would have been completely isolated with multiple injuries.
